There has never been a better time to grow your business in L.A.
L.A. has a $1 trillion metro economy, 20 million consumers, and billions in record-breaking venture deals, infrastructure projects, and public procurement annually. We are the gateway to global opportunities with six commercial airports and the largest port complex in the Western Hemisphere. Companies choose the Los Angeles region to reach the U.S. consumer market and establish a launchpad to the world.
In 2018, Los Angeles reached an historic milestone of welcoming 50 million visitors. We anticipate exceeding this number in the next three years and reaching over $20 billion in visitor spending.
The twin ports of Los Angeles and Long Beach are the top two ports in the Western Hemisphere, receiving 40% of all inbound containers in the United States
The Los Angeles International Airport (LAX) ranks 3rd in the world for passengers (LAWA) and 8th in the world for air cargo.
The Regional Alliance Marketplace for Procurement (RAMP) makes available more than $10 billion in procurement opportunities a year.
With nearly 4,000 venture-backed startups in the city, Los Angeles is the third-largest startup market in the U.S.

Over 26,000 international students attend universities in L.A. County.
Four of the top 20 universities in the world are in California.
Los Angeles has the most engineers of any city in the United States, with over 70,000 currently working in the area.
The Los Angeles Community College District is the largest in the nation with over 230,000 full and part time students on its 9 campuses.
